JWELL develops the parallel twin screw extrusion line for PET sheet, this line equipped with degassing system, and no need drying and crystallizing unit. The extrusion line has the properties of low energy comsuption, simple production process and easy maintenance. The segmented screw structure can reduce the viscosity loss of PET resin, the symmetrical and thin-wall calender roller highten the cooling effect and improve the capactity and sheet quality. Multi components dosing feeder can control the percentage of virgin material, recycling material and master batch precisely, the sheet is widely used for thermoforming packaging industry.

PLA (Polylactic Acid) is a novel biobased and renewable biodegradable material made from starch raw materials proposed by renewable plant resources such as corn and cassava. The production process of PLA is non-polluting, and the product can be biodegraded to achieve circulation in nature, so it is an ideal green polymer material. PLA has good thermal stability, processing temperature of 170-230℃, with good solvent resistance. Products made of PLA have the advantage of biodegradability, gloss, transparency,good feel and heat resistance. It also has good antibacterial, flame retardant and UV resistance, so it can be used in rigid packaging of fruits, vegetables, eggs, cooked foods and baked goods. It can also be used for the packaging of sandwiches, biscuits and flowers,etc.

Underwater cutting system
Advance underwater cutting system can produce elliptical pellet with high automation, the closed system has no emission of smoke and dust to environment and can adapt to various capacity requirements.
Dosing system
Raw material of bio-plastic, starch and plasticizer are fed into twin screw extruder via accurate LIW feeders separately with high automation and flexibility to adjust formulation.
Downstream auxiliary equipments
Rich and reasonable downstream equipments realize homogenization, sieving, drying & cooling until automatic packing smoothly
Compounding system
Modular twin screw extruder equipped with super high torque gearbox, wear resistant & corrosive resistant barrels and screw elements, high torque shaft and safety clutch, efficient heating and precise control to ensure stable, reliable and long term production.

PLA/PBT Meltblown Non-woven Fabric is mainly made of polypropylene, and the fiber diameter can reach 1 ~ 5 microns. There are many voids, fluffy structure, and good anti-wrinkle ability. These ultrafine fibers with unique capillary structure increase the number and surface area of fibers per unit area, so that the meltblown cloth has good filterability, shielding, heat insulation and oil absorption . Can be used in the fields of air, liquid filter materials, mask materials, thermal insulation materials, oil-absorbing materials etc.
